CVE-2016-8605

17
FAUCET Score

CVE-2016-8605 describes a vulnerability in GNU Guile's mkdir procedure, where it temporarily set the process umask to zero. This could lead to other threads in a multithreaded application creating files or directories with insecure permissions (e.g., 0777) during this brief window, affecting Guile versions prior to 2.0.13 and various Fedora products. Rated 5.3 MEDIUM (C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:L/A:N), the vulnerability is network-exploitable with low attack complexity, potentially leading to information integrity issues. There is no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code, or significant community discussion surrounding this CVE.
